1.
On May 23, 2013, this Court referred the present case to the Honorable
Leslie G. Foschio, United States Magistrate Judge, to hear all dispositive motions and
file a report and recommendation containing findings of fact, conclusions of law and a
recommended disposition of any such motion pursuant to 28 U.S.C. ' 636(b)(1)(B) and
(C). In July of that year, this Court accepted Judge Foschio=s recommendation to grant
Plaintiff=s request for interpleader relief, permit the depositing of the contested funds,
and dismiss Plaintiff from this action.
2.
On October 17, 2013, Defendants Donte R. Smith, Armontae Moss, Mary
Moss, and Travante D. Johnson moved for the entry of a default judgment in their favor
against Defendant Ronald T. Epps. A default was previously entered against Epps by
the Clerk of this Court on December 18, 2012.
3.
On August 6, 2014, Judge Foschio filed a Report and Recommendation
recommending that the moving Defendants= motion be denied.
4.
No objections to the Report and Recommendation were received from any
party within fourteen (14) days from the date of its service, in accordance with 28
U.S.C. ' 636(b)(1)(C) and Rule 72(b) of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ure and the
Local Rules of Civil Procedure of this Court.
IT HEREBY IS ORDERED, that this Court accepts Judge Foschio=s Report and
Recommendation (Docket No. 54) in its entirety and the moving Defendants= motion for
a default judgment (Docket No. 43) is DENIED.
